For $25 you get all of that and the chance to ensure future development of the only complete OSS office suite for the Mac that doesn’t require X11 and integreates with Mac OSX. Moreover, the NeoOffice team provides free, annonymous CVS access and step-by-step build instructions, so this is _nothing_ like MS charging for a Beta.īy joining the EAP, you are paying for the packaging, early access and the time that it saves compiling yourself.

#Paying for neooffice full#

The full source code is already available under the GPL. The EAP is a voluntary fundraiser for the developers. NeoOffice 2.0 Alpha 4 and the earlier 1.22 are already available for free download.
